Data Centers Find New Protection

Data centers, vital for AI, may soon use special bonds to protect against major disasters, changing how risk is managed.

Data centers hold all the information powering our world, especially artificial intelligence. They are vital, but also face risks like natural disasters or power outages. Protecting these centers is a big challenge. Insurance companies help, but now a new idea is emerging.

Soon, these crucial data centers might get protection from something called a catastrophe bond. These bonds are a way to share big risks with investors. When a data center faces a major problem, these bonds can provide the money needed to fix it. This is a new path for protecting these important facilities.

Experts believe the first specific deal for data centers could happen within the next 12 to 18 months. This means investors will soon have a way to support these centers while also taking on some risk. It helps spread the cost of huge problems away from just one insurer.

This move helps data centers keep running even after a disaster. It also opens up a new market for money managers. This ensures our digital future stays secure, no matter what happens.
